During the early afternoon people from Maldon begin to gather at the front gates. They're carrying signs and one of them has a megaphone. They begin setting up, holding up signs that read such gems as 'No Mutant Maldon' and 'Muties Out' or simply a stylized strand of DNA inside a red circle with a red bar across it. All in all maybe two dozen people gather and take up position just outside the gate where they're easily visible from the Manor.
